Step 4: Migrate DocSweep rules. New hires: DocSweep lints all Markdown under /guides before merge. Copy the legacy rule set from the Quillbank repo into docsweep.toml, then delete the old config. Run docsweep --verify twice; the first pass rebuilds the cache. The verifier also checks that lint results persist to the audit database, so point it at the following.

replica DSN, tawef-hahap: mysql://eliix_svc:FiIC0jz@db-394a.lumiclabs.internal:5432/holius

### Partition Management

The Corvid ledger API partitions the `events` table by calendar month. New partitions are created automatically three days before month end; old partitions detach after the retention window of 13 months. The release manager should verify partition creation before each monthly deploy using the `/partitions/status` endpoint, which returns the active partition list and row counts. Requests to this endpoint require authentication with the bearer token provided below.

portal login ticket: eyJhbGciOiJIUzI1NiIsInR5cCI6IkpXVCJ9.eyJzdWIiOiIMjvRAf3PEFIn0.nuv9gjixLtnr

# Env Vars — CartStorm Load Tests

Load tests hit the Pellwick checkout flow in staging only. Never point at prod. Set CARTSTORM_TARGET to the staging host, CARTSTORM_VUS to 50 max, and CARTSTORM_DURATION in seconds. Results land in the shared dashboard automatically. Copy .env.sample to .env before running anything. The synthetic payment gateway requires authentication, so add its key on the very next line.

sealed setting: ARCHIVE_KEY3=8d0

Q3 PLANNING NOTE — Finance Team

Subject: Pricing, Kestrel line.

Current list prices on Kestrel Mini and Kestrel Pro hold through Q3. Kestrel Max moves up 4% effective start of quarter to offset component costs. No promotional discounts beyond standard channel terms. Margin target: 38% blended across the line. Deviation requests route through Priya before quote issue. Volume breaks above 500 units require sign-off. Model the sensitivity scenarios by week two and flag anything off-plan. One item is restricted and follows below.

board note of tadup-tajog: Headcount on the Oliiel team goes from 31 to 88 by the end of February. Gross margin on Oliiel came in at 62 percent against a plan of 29 percent.